Stars in ancient cultures
The star is a symbol of eternity, high ideals. In ancient times, it was believed that each person has his own star, which is born and dies with it. This connected the fate of man with the astral body, and this laid the foundation for the development of the science of astrology.
A star is a symbol of plurality, order. But the deep meaning of this image depends on the shape, number of corners and color.
Number of corners
The meaning of the triangular star tattoo is displayed in the Bible. This symbol represents the All-Seeing Eye, the Providence of the Lord. A quadrangular star is a symbol of light, it indicates the correct path and is associated with the cross, while the five-pointed star represents the image of a person from outer space and acts as a talisman. In ancient Egypt, it denoted the ascent to the beginning and was used as a hieroglyph, which was present in such words as “teacher”, “enlightenment” and so on. The meaning of the tattoo "star inverted" speaks of black magic and evil spirits.

The six-winged star of David, or the seal of Solomon, (two intersecting triangles of blue) was a talisman, translated from the Hebrew language means "God-protector." This symbol was previously used to protect against evil and represented the primacy of God over the entire universe. It is believed that this image arose after David's victory over Goliath, after which he became king of Israel. The white six-winged star (Bethlehem) represents the Nativity of Christ, and the heptagonal - the East, the mystical side of man, his perfection. The octagonal star is the symbol of the cross (doubled four-pointed star), abundance, and the nine-winged one is the stability that everyone aspires to. It is also an image of nine worlds and good health. The twelve-pointed star is an image of perfection.
The meaning of the tattoo "star" in some variations
Starfish has long been used as a talisman from the water element, therefore, it was mainly made by sailors. A falling star means some important event in a person’s life, impending changes. Magic and miracles, the fulfillment of desires, are displayed by a star located in any constellation or near the crescent. Masons, on the other hand, believed that a star burning in a flame represents the mystical center, the energy of the Universe.
Tattoo location
The meaning of the star tattoo on the arm, namely on the wrist, is the symbol of lesbians. And if a woman places her on another part of the body, it can act as an accessory or a simple decoration in order to attract attention.
In the thieves' world, a hexagonal star called the Windrose is placed on the forearm under the epaulettes. Its carrier must have thieves' concepts. Also, jailers often put stars on their elbows. This means that the person "will not give a hand to the cop." The tattoo of a star on its knees has the following meaning: a person will never obey the law and will not kneel before him. If the image is applied to the collarbone, this suggests that its carrier is an authoritative recidivist thief.
